On the Mavics you will need the Mavic spacer, which is 1.75mm and you will also need the Shimano 10 speed cassette spacer which is 1mm.
The Fulcrums will just need the Shimano 10 speed spacer at 1mm.
Edit to correct Mavic shim to 1.75mm not 1.85mm, that was the Shimano 11 speed to 10 speed shim.
